Legislature orders look see into liquor board procedures

The Legislative Research Committee unanimously authorizes a look at how the State Liquor Commission lists brands in state stores and licenses liquor salesmen who sell to the state. Rep. Albert E. Cote says complaints support the review, while Chairman Louis Jalbert labels it a study not an investigation.

Lawmakers Demand Inquiry Into Maine Liquor Listings

Rep. Melvin Lane charges lax enforcement and alleges criminal activity including Cosa Nostra operations and gambling. The research panel authorizes a look see of liquor listings while Dubord finds no evidence to substantiate the charges against the commission's chief of enforcement Timothy J. Murphy. A Kennebec County grand jury heard the remarks and found no indictable offenses.

Pease AFB Jet Lands Safely After Gear Jammed Belly Landing

A six engine B47 Stratojet crash landed at Pease AFB Newington New Hampshire after circling nearly five hours with a jammed landing gear. Four crew members walked away unaided. an eyewitness called it a perfect belly landing. The crew were Lt. Col. James B. Price Capt. Yale R. Davis Jr. Capt. Ronald L. Newton First Lt. Charles S. Franco.

Conferees Agree On Historic Medicare Bill

Washington conferees reached a six party agreement on a comprehensive Medicare bill to cover older Americans. The plan would tax the first 6600 of income to fund the expanded Social Security program, with debates over whether benefits should total 6 or 7 billion dollars and who pays.

McNamara cites Viet Cong force balance as burden on South Vietnam

Secretary McNamara returned from Vietnam stating the Viet Cong force total around 165000 while the government forces number about 500000. He said the Viet Cong to government ratio is totally unacceptable and signaled a push for increased U S strength in South Vietnam to offset guerrilla pressure.

Roadway Injunction Sought in Saco Dispute

The Charles Shulman family trust and Allied Chemical Coatings seek an injunction in Portland in a right of way dispute with Saco Tanning Corp. The property lies between Allied and Saco plants and Allied claims a right to use the roadway, which Saco Tanning denies. Justice Harold C. Marden is hearing the case.

Merry-Go-Round Still Top Attraction At Old Orchard Beach

The merry go round on the Old Orchard Beach pier remains a leading draw for two generations of vacationers. Built in 1924 as an exact duplicate of the pre fire ride, it features 50 carved animals and two chariots by William Dentzel. The ride, repaired each fall by artist Otho Baker, uses a modern transmission, and its gold painted menagerie is the first open at summer and last open after Labor Day.
